About PEAK
PEAK is a paid media agency based in Manchester city centre. We plan, build and run paid social and performance campaigns for a client roster that spans UK fitness, DTC homeware and consumer goods, beauty, and US luxury fragrance.
We are a team of five and growing off the back of new business. The founders still do the work themselves rather than selling an account and handing it to a junior, and we expect the same of everyone we hire.
Our view of performance is straightforward. Results come from creative quality and account structure far more than from targeting. Most of what we do day to day follows from that.
The Role
This is a role for someone with a couple of years behind them who is ready to run accounts properly rather than execute someone else's plan.
Responsibilities
- Own day-to-day management of a portfolio of paid social accounts across Meta and TikTok
- Build and maintain campaign structures that make performance legible and testing possible
- Plan and run structured creative testing across hooks, formats, angles and offers, and act on what the results actually show
- Brief creative, and give useful feedback on it rather than passing it through
- Own budget pacing, bid strategy and in-platform optimisation against client targets
- Produce weekly and monthly reporting that explains what happened and what you are doing about it
- Work directly with clients on calls, in reviews and over email
- Keep on top of platform changes and feed the useful ones back into the team

What We Are Looking For
Essential:
- 2+ years managing paid social campaigns, in-house or agency
- Hands-on experience in Meta Ads Manager with real budget responsibility
- A working understanding of measurement, including attribution windows, GA4, and the difference between platform-reported and actual
- The ability to look at a set of results and form a view, rather than reporting the numbers back
- Genuine attention to detail. Naming conventions, ad copy, crops, UTMs, spelling. The small things compound
- Comfortable talking to clients directly and explaining your reasoning

What Matters More Than the CV
We are looking for someone who cares about the work and takes some pride in it. Curiosity about why one ad worked and the ones around it did not. A willingness to say when something is not working, including when it is your own idea.
